Merge remote-tracking branch 'arm64/for-next/scs' into for-next/core
* arm64/for-next/scs: arm64: sdei: Push IS_ENABLED() checks down to callee functions arm64: scs: use vmapped IRQ and SDEI shadow stacks scs: switch to vmapped shadow stacks
